Transaction 73cc826f7b18411eee357df9ef7126edc70044c7589340b53a30033e88942150
1 Input
1 Output
-
73cc826f7b18411eee357df9ef7126edc70044c7589340b53a30033e88942150:0
- value
- 8757147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c54fd0cf7e8d50e594f7b7659bec078a418037ae OP_EQUAL
- address
- MRtSxum88vRLdwVMfTudkH4nyy8y5mBwRs